Chicago Fizz (1930) The cocktail to follow up a workout. (adapted from The Savory Cocktail Book by Harry Craddock) 1/2 oz. simple syrup 3/4 oz. fresh lemon juice 1 oz. white rum 1 oz. port the white of one egg To make: Dry shake (without ice) to emulsify the egg white, shake again with ice, strain into a chilled glass, top with soda. “This drink checks in at a very respectable 160 calories, less than some beers,” says Present “while the egg white gives you 3.6 grams of protein”
